Output 12bc2a53d0a7de6cd317666cfea7042f112988e20bbaae02cee429a4f455c9e6:6

value
4087988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e2363a604dbc3200985521c5fddbfcd2026b392 OP_EQUAL
address
32ymn7nFQwguNwUBvNKGqunuV4uw7kSBnj
transaction
12bc2a53d0a7de6cd317666cfea7042f112988e20bbaae02cee429a4f455c9e6
confirmations
255684
spent
true